Okay. *wipes sweat from brow*
Complete music/soundtrack staff (instruments/roles included), in addition to regular staff that were skipped over were added to the following titles between yesterday and today:
- Akira
- Evangelion (TV & End)
- FLCL
- .hack//DUSK
- .hack//Liminality
- .hack//SIGN
- Hellsing
- Irresponsible Captain Tylor
- Rurouni Kenshin OVA (Tsuioku Hen)
- Trigun
- Wolf's Rain
Something amazing to me as I finished up with Wolf's Rain is the amount of non-Japanese music staff. There were musicians from Brazil, Italy, Poland and the United States that contributed pieces to this soundtrack, and boy is it a great soundtrack. I am currently in love with the Raju Ramayya song "Strangers."
